    If you are about to post a brag that you know is about - or endorsing yours or others - coupon misuse, manipulation, or otherwise fraud of coupons or stores - please do not bother posting about it at all on Smart Canucks. Smart Canucks does not endorse illegal activity of any kind.

    Thanks for taking a stand on this - I once accidentally misused a coupon because I saw someone posting a deal using a certain coupon, I thought they had the right product for that coupon but it turns out that it was that line but no for that specific product. I was not too happy when I found out I misused a coupon. Hopefully this post will keep more situations like mine from happening.

    Ask in a friendly tone. Personally I am more likely to respond to a friendly inquiry than anything else. I'm sure most people are the same. SC is a friendly place to learn and share ideas about shopping and saving.

    Snarkiness or passively-aggressive posting/answering questions doesn't make anyone any friends.
